A Must-Visit Destination in Queenstown, New Zealand General Information Coronet Peak is a popular ski resort located in Queenstown, New Zealand.

It is known for its stunning views, diverse terrain, and excellent facilities. The resort has been providing top-notch winter sports activities for over 70 years and is also a great destination for summer adventure activities.

What You Can See and Do Coronet Peak offers a wide range of activities throughout the year. In the winter season, you can enjoy skiing, snowboarding, and a variety of other snow activities. There are 280 hectares of ski terrain, and with state-of-the-art snowmaking equipment, visitors can enjoy skiing and snowboarding from June to October.

The summer season at Coronet peak is equally exciting, with a range of activities to choose from. Visitors can take part in mountain biking, hiking, sightseeing, and paragliding. For those who want to experience the thrill of downhill mountain biking, the resort offers world-class trails, including beginner and advanced level terrains.

Cafe 1200 Cafe 1200, located at the top of Coronet Peak, is an iconic cafe offering breathtaking views of the surrounding landscapes. Open during the summer season, the cafe is conveniently located next to the chairlift, making it a perfect stop for those enjoying outdoor adventures at the resort. The menu at Cafe 1200 offers a range of food and drinks to suit all tastes. However, it should be noted that the prices can be expensive.

When Should You Go Coronet Peak is open all year round, but the best time to visit depends on what you want to do. If you are interested in winter sports, then June to October is the best time to visit. However, if you want to experience the summer adventures that Coronet Peak has to offer, then December to April is the best time to go.

How to Get There Coronet Peak is located just 16km from the Queenstown town centre, and it takes around 25 minutes to drive there. Visitors can take the Coronet Peak access road, which is sealed, or take a shuttle bus from Queenstown. The resort also offers a free shuttle service from the town during the winter season.
